Tangy Lemon Rasam Recipe for Steamed Rice

Lemon Rasam is a light, tangy, and aromatic soup that’s perfect as a starter or to enjoy with steamed rice. Infused with lemon juice, tamarind, and traditional spices, it’s simple to make and packed with flavor. Here’s how to make it perfectly at home.

Ingredients



  • 1 tablespoon tamarind paste or a small lemon-sized ball of tamarind, soaked in water
  • 4 cups water
  • 1-2 green chilies, slit
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per, crushed
  • 1 teaspoon cumin seeds
  • 2 garlic cloves, crushed (optional)
  • 1 medium tomato, chopped
  • 1/4 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ice (adjust to taste)
  • 2 teaspoons coriander leaves,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on ghee or oil
  • Salt, to taste


Step-by-Step Instructions



1. Prepare the Tamarind Base

If using tamarind ball, soak it in warm water for 10-15 minutes. Extract the pulp and discard the fibers. This forms the tangy base of your rasam.


2. Cook the Spices

In a saucepan, heat ghee or oil. Add cumin seeds, crushed black pepper, and garlic. Sauté for a minute until fragrant.

3. Add Tomatoes and Turmeric

Add chopped tomatoes and turmeric powder. Cook until the tomatoes soften and release their juices.

4. Add Tamarind Water

Pour in the tamarind water and regular water. Bring it to a gentle boil. Add slit green chilies and salt. Simmer for 5-7 minutes.

5. Finish with Lemon Juice

Turn off the heat and stir in fresh lemon juice. This preserves the bright, tangy flavor. Garnish with chopped coriander leaves.


6. Serve Hot

Lemon Rasam can be enjoyed as a soup or poured over steamed rice for a comforting meal.

Tips for Perfect Lemon Rasam



  • Adjust the amount of lemon juice based on how tangy you like it.
  • Freshly crushed black pepper adds warmth and subtle spice.
  • Add a pinch of asafoetida (hing) while sautéing spices for an authentic flavor.
  • Rasam is best served hot and fresh.
